HC Deb 20 March 1967 vol 743 c188W
74. Mr. Driberg

asked the Minister of Public Building and Works if he is aware that the lifts recently installed in the House of Commons are apt to halt between floors and are exceptionally slow; and if he will consult engineers with experience of installing lifts in hotels and other public buildings, with a view to providing faster and more dependable lifts for the use of hon. Members.

Mr. Prentice

There have been no recent mechanical failures in the lifts. However, if they are overloaded they may not behave normally; and if the stop or emergency buttons are pressed by mistake, the lifts would come to a halt between floors. They travel at the normal speed for lifts serving only a few floors.

There are experienced specialists in lift engineering on the staff of my Department, who give first-class service to the House of Commons.
